如何选择适合自己的编程软件:新手应考虑哪些因素

时间:2025-12-07 分类:电脑软件

挑选适合自己的编程软件,对新手而言,确实是一个重要且可能令人困惑的任务。市场上编程软件种类繁多,涉及的编程语言也各不相同,这让程序员在选择时面临诸多选择。了解当前的市场趋势、软件功能和个人需求,能够帮助新手做出更明智的选择。

如何选择适合自己的编程软件:新手应考虑哪些因素

技术的快速发展使得编程软件不断更新迭代,市面上有许多流行的开发环境,如Visual Studio Code、PyCharm和Eclipse等。选择一款合适的编程软件,有助于提高编程效率,减少学习曲线。对于新手而言,选择时可以考虑以下几个方面。

一个重要的因素是编程语言的需求。不同的编程软件支持的语言各不相同,例如,Python爱好者可能会更倾向选择PyCharm,而Web开发者则会选择Visual Studio Code或Sublime Text。了解自身需求,选择与学习目标相符的软件,是入门编程的第一步。

界面友好性也是选择编程软件时需考虑的重要因素。富有直观设计的软件能够减少学习时间,有助于新手快速熟悉开发环境。例如,对于初学者来说,IDE(集成开发环境)如IntelliJ IDEA提供了丰富的功能和工具,可以帮助他们高效地完成项目。而像Visual Studio Code这样的轻量级编辑器则方便新手在开始时专注于基础知识的学习。

功能扩展性是另一个需要关注的点。很多编程软件都支持插件和扩展,例如Visual Studio Code拥有丰富的插件生态,可以根据个人需求进行定制。新手在选择时可以考虑未来的发展方向,选择一款能够随时扩展其功能的软件,能够满足未来的需求。

社区和学习资源的丰富程度也不能忽视。强大且活跃的社区往往能够提供技术支持、讨论以及学习资源。像GitHub、Stack Overflow等平台上,相关编程软件的社区支持通常能为新手解决不少问题。

价格和许可协议也是需要考虑的方面。有些编程软件是免费的,而有些则需要购买许可证。新手在选择时,可以根据自己的预算进行合理选择,确保在预算范围内获得最佳的使用体验。

通过以上分析,新手在选择编程软件时,可以更有针对性地找到符合自己需求的工具,从而提升学习效率,避免不必要的挫折。技术日趋更新,灵活应用编程软件的各种功能,将为编程之路打下坚实的基础。

常见问题解答(FAQ)

1. 新手学习编程应该选择哪种语言?

Python是一个不错的选择,因其简单易学,适合快速入门。

2. 有什么免费的编程软件推荐吗?

Visual Studio Code和Atom都是非常受欢迎的免费编辑器,功能强大且易于使用。

3. 我可以同时使用多个编程软件吗?

可以,根据不同的项目需求和个人喜好,使用多个软件是完全可以的。

4. 如何获取编程学习资源?

网上有很多学习平台,如Coursera、Udemy,以及YouTube上也有不少优质教程。

5. 选择编程软件时最关键的是什么?

根据自己的需求和未来的发展方向,选择功能适合、易于使用的软件最为关键。